Three men have been arrested from Punjabi Bagh for allegedly stealing vehicles with the help of hi-tech gadgets and selling them in Assam, the police said on Thursday.
The accused were identified as Deepak (26) and Ankit (28), residents of Narnaund in Haryana and Rinku (27), of Gohana, they added.
The police received information that a stolen car parked in Uttam Nagar was going to be transported to Assam, a senior police officer said, adding that a trap was laid based on the tip-off. “After sometime, a cab stopped near the car under surveillance. Deepak got down from it and when he opened the door of the car, he was arrested,” DCP (West) Monika Bhardwaj said.
